Add backend-specific lowering for cumsum/cumprod on TPU. (#2614)
* Add backend-specific lowering for cumsum/cumprod on TPU.
Make cumsum/cumprod primitives so they can have backend-specific lowerings.
* Disable cumulative reduction gradient test on TPU.